The Consequences of Deforestation

Deforestation has severe consequences for our environment, wildlife, and climate. Trees absorb carbon dioxide, produce oxygen, and provide habitats for countless species. Without them, we risk losing the very foundation of our ecosystem. Moreover, deforestation contributes to climate change by releasing stored carbon into the atmosphere.
